A kind of copper junk pollution discharge treating device
Technical field
The utility model is a kind of copper junk pollution discharge treating device, belongs to copper pipe processing disposal unit field.
Background technique
Many leftover bits can be generated during copper pipe processing, these waste materials can be infected with many oil during output Stain and dirt, it has not been convenient to be recycled, in the prior art, be treated in journey usually to copper junk only by washing away Mode is cleaned, and cleaning effect is poor, it is difficult to realize the cleaning of stain, and the water flow after flushing collects inconvenience, wastes water Resource, so needing a kind of copper junk pollution discharge treating device to solve the above-mentioned problem.

Fig. 1-Fig. 3 is please referred to, the utility model provides a kind of technical solution: a kind of copper junk pollution discharge treating device, including Cylinder 1 and waste material are removed contamination component, and waste material component of removing contamination is mounted on 1 upper end of cylinder, waste material remove contamination component include porous plate 2, it is perpendicular To ball nut mount 3, vertical screw rod 4, right scraper plate 5, right longitudinal ball nut mount 6, right longitudinal screw mandrel 7, carrier 8, after-poppet 10, Fore-stock 11, left longitudinal screw mandrel 13, left scraper plate 14 and left longitudinal ball nut mount 15, porous plate 2 are arranged inside cylinder 1, 2 upper surface medium position of porous plate processes through-hole, and vertical ball nut mount 3, which runs through, to be fixed on inside through-hole, vertical 4 lower end of screw rod It is applied in inside vertical ball nut mount 3, vertical 4 upper end of screw rod passes through 8 upper surface of carrier, and extends to 8 upside of carrier, carrier 8 are fixed on 1 upper surface of cylinder, and fore-stock 11 is mounted on the ground of 1 front side of cylinder, and after-poppet 10 is mounted on 1 rear side of cylinder On ground, right 7 front end of longitudinal screw mandrel passes through 11 front end face of fore-stock, and right 7 rear end of longitudinal screw mandrel passes through 10 end face of after-poppet, and the right side is vertical It is sleeved on right 7 annular side of longitudinal screw mandrel to ball nut mount 6, right scraper plate 5 is fixed on 6 lower end surface of right longitudinal ball nut mount, Left 13 rear end of longitudinal screw mandrel passes through 10 rear end face of after-poppet in right 7 left side of longitudinal screw mandrel, and left 13 front end of longitudinal screw mandrel passes through right vertical To 10 front end face of after-poppet in 7 left side of screw rod, left longitudinal direction ball nut mount 15 is sleeved on left 13 annular side of longitudinal screw mandrel, and a left side is scraped Plate 14 is fixed on 15 lower end surface of left longitudinal ball nut mount, in use, copper junk is deposited in the circle of 2 upside of porous plate Inside cylinder 1, is delivered to the operation of water flow conveying equipment water flow inside cylinder 1 by water inlet pipe, copper junk is rinsed And impregnate, being soaked for a period of time rear staff runs motor one, to drive vertical screw rod 4 to rotate, in ball nut pair Under the action of one, vertical ball nut mount 3 drives porous plate 2 to move up to drive copper junk movement, while in water inlet pipe Water flow continue to be rinsed copper junk, flushing effect is good, and when copper junk is moved to 1 upper end of cylinder, staff makes electricity Machine two is run, so that left longitudinal screw mandrel 13 be driven to rotate, the left rotation of longitudinal screw mandrel 13 band movable belt pulley one is rotated, and the rotation of belt wheel one is logical It crosses transmission belt band movable belt pulley two to rotate, so that left longitudinal direction ball nut mount 15 drives a left side to scrape under the action of ball nut pair two Plate 14 is mobile, and under the action of ball nut pair three, right longitudinal direction ball nut mount 6 drives right scraper plate 5 mobile, will be on porous plate 2 Cylinder waste material scrape to preceding conveyer belt 12 and rear conveyer belt 9, the design is good to the cleaning effect of copper junk, and save water money Source.
Baffle before 1 annular side upper front end of cylinder is fixed, baffle after 1 annular side upper rear end of cylinder is fixed, is convenient for Copper junk output is oriented to.
Conveyer belt 12 before being installed between fore-stock 11 and cylinder 1, conveyer belt 9 after being installed between after-poppet 10 and cylinder 1, just The output of copper junk after cleaning.
Vertical ball nut mount 3 is connected by ball nut pair one with vertical screw rod 4, is realized vertical screw rod 4 Rotating operation is converted to the purpose of linear running, and left longitudinal direction ball nut mount 15 passes through ball nut pair two and left longitudinal screw mandrel 13 It is connected, realizes the purpose that the rotating operation of left longitudinal screw mandrel 13 is converted to linear running, right longitudinal direction ball nut mount 6 is logical It crosses ball nut mount three to be connected with right longitudinal screw mandrel 7, realizes and the rotating operation of right longitudinal screw mandrel 7 is converted into linear running Purpose.
Motor one is installed in 8 upper surface hold-down support of carrier, support inside, and vertical 4 lower end of screw rod, which is connected to the motor, to be connect, and is convenient for The rotation of vertical screw rod 4.
11 front end face of fore-stock fixes support plate, and motor two, left 13 front end of longitudinal screw mandrel and motor two are installed in support plate upper surface Rear end is connected, convenient for the rotation of left longitudinal screw mandrel 13.
13 rear end of left longitudinal screw mandrel of the rear side of after-poppet 10 is set with belt wheel one, after the right longitudinal screw mandrel 7 of 10 rear side of after-poppet End cap fills belt wheel two, and belt wheel one is connected by transmission belt with belt wheel two, convenient for the same of left longitudinal screw mandrel 13 and right longitudinal screw mandrel 7 Shi Xuanzhuan.
Water inlet pipe is installed on 1 annular side top of cylinder, and water inlet pipe is connected by hose with water flow conveying equipment, is convenient for water The input of stream, and 1 annular side of cylinder on the downside of water inlet pipe installs drainpipe, Water collecting tube, Water collecting tube lower end are installed in 1 lower end of cylinder And 1 lower end of cylinder passes through hose and is connected with water flow recycling equipment, extra water flow is along row during cleaning Water pipe flows to inside Water collecting tube, and flows to inside water flow recycling equipment, convenient for the discharge and recovery processing of sewage.
